[pdf] The SC connector, also known as the Subscriber Connector or Square Connector, is a common choice for data communication. It uses a push-pull locking mechanism that makes connections quick and secure. A fiber optic connector is a mechanical device that links two optical fibers so that light can be transmitted with minimum attenuation.
